Colorado HUD Homes for sale

HUD Homes in Colorado is offering very good incentives right now to buy a Colorado Home, whether you are a Colorado home Buyer and if you bid for the full amount of the listing price or more and if you do a loan through a FHA lender, you'll only pay a down payment of $100.00, Yes! Only $100.00, also you can ask for a total of 3% for seller concessions. HUD homes in Colorado these days have a high demand for its great incentives that offer to Colorado home buyers.

There is many inventory to choose and great prices to get. A difference from Lender Owned homes in Colorado is that do not accept to deal with FHA Loans, the reason is because FHA have very strict regulations and check more in deep the condition of a Colorado home for sale. The condition of a Colorado home for sale needs to be habitable for good, these regulations are great and they protect the Colorado Home buyer and they protect the FHA lender.

I think the $100 incentive is great. And it's good for 203k's too, in case there are appraisal issues, there is potential to convert it to a 203k and still do the $100 down. Great deal for the buyer either way. Do you see many HUD homes being sold for more than the list price?
